Civil Unrest As A Pretext For Presidential Lawlessness

We will’t speak in regards to the protests in Los Angeles towards mass deportation and President Trump itching to ship within the army and not using a fast reminder that all of us knew there was a particularly excessive danger that if Trump have been re-elected he would provoke civil unrest in an effort to use it as a pretext for lawless actions he was already decided to take.

It’s too early to say whether or not this specific incident finally ends up being the defining episode of the erosion of the road between the army and home legislation enforcement. However it’s comprehensible why everybody has a hair set off about Trump sending within the Nationwide Guard over the objections of California Gov. Gavin Newsom (D).

Two issues particularly:

  • The President’s memo was concerningly open-ended. It didn’t specify Los Angeles or California; it applies wherever. It empowered the protection secretary “to make use of another members of the common Armed Forces as obligatory.” It broadly outlined protests as rebel: “To the extent that protests or acts of violence immediately inhibit the execution of the legal guidelines, they represent a type of rebel towards the authority of the Authorities of the US.”
  • Protection Secretary Pete Hegseth made a giant deal over the weekend a couple of detachment of 500 Marines at Twentynine Palms being prepared to supply backup to the Nationwide Guard.

A former performing vice chief of the Nationwide Guard Bureau advised Fox Information: “That is an inappropriate use of the Nationwide Guard and isn’t warranted.”

The Purges: FBI Retribution Version

The Trump administration has compelled out two senior FBI officers and punished a 3rd for his friendship with former FBI agent Peter Strzok, the longtime Trump goal.

Proud Boys Sue Over Jan. 6

Proud Boys Enrique Tarrio, Zachary Rehl, Ethan Nordean, Joseph Biggs and Dominic Pezzola – all convicted within the Jan. 6 assault then given clemency by President Trump – have sued prosecutors and FBI brokers in federal courtroom in Florida over their prosecutions, demanding $100 million in punitive damages.

A Mom Lode Of Extremist Supplies

An alleged sequence of thefts of fight gear from an Military Ranger regiment in Washington state led to the arrest earlier this month of two veterans at a house stuffed with Nazi and white supremacy paraphernalia and a stockpile of stolen weapons, the NYT studies.

DOGE Watch

  • A 6-3 Supreme Courtroom granted DOGE entry to confidential Social Safety data, with Justice Ketanji Brown Jackson blasting the choice in a written dissent joined by Justice Sonia Sotomayor.
  • Over the objections of the three liberal justices, the Supreme Courtroom in the reduction of the scope of discovery the watchdog group CREW can search from DOGE.
  • Frank Bisignano, the brand new head of the Social Safety Administration, declared himself to be “basically a DOGE individual.” 

Trump’s Ban On AP Reinstated

In a extensively panned resolution, two Trump appointees on the D.C. Circuit Courtroom of Appeals largely reinstated the Trump White Home’s ban on the Related Press in retaliation for not utilizing “Gulf of America” in its tales.

Federal Judges Are Begging Us to Pay Consideration

Adam Bonica used computational textual content evaluation to look at judicial choices in almost 300 instances involving the Trump administration and located what he referred to as an “institutional refrain of constitutional alarm“:

The sharp language from the bench isn’t judicial activism; it’s the sound of democracy’s protection mechanisms underneath unprecedented stress. These interventions span the political spectrum. Judges have been responding to not partisan disagreement however to actions that crossed elementary authorized and constitutional traces.

The alarm is being sounded by conservative and liberal judges in a variety of instances, a lot of which you’ll be acquainted with from Morning Memo.
